I've got the newest troubles to solve. Let's take a look:

We have a LAN connected to a Zyxel 312 Firewall connected to a Zyxel 100IH ISDN router. Everything was fine until today afternoon. Suddenly it happend that we were no longer able to access any webserver by http.

We can get the router to dial in as usual. We can ping any remote computer, as well as email (pop & smtp), as well as ftp. But when we want to access a website, using a bookmark or by inputting a web adress directly, it doesn't do anything. <b>M$ IE 5 says "the web page cannot be displayed", and Netscape 4.72 says "connection reset from the opposite side".</b>

You can imagine that we *really* didn't change anything. :( In addition I called the ISP but he said there is no problem. I veryfied this with a dial-in by modem from a notebook. BTW this is the computer I'm sitting in front of and try to get some help. And trying to let the router dial into another dial-in number didn't work either (dialed in, ping and all ok but http).

Turn off / turn on the firewall and the router didn't help either. Switching off the firewall software module of the firewall box didn't help either. Turn off / turn on the Win98 & Win2K workstations didn't help either. :(

Can you access the internet by typing in the numeric web address? Try typing in 209.68.1.53 in your web address. If the page loads, then it would appear that you have DNS problems.
